Output bacc26d565252b2b23a6f1e53ed3ecc786163b945414afb6c1c686640d06085d:0

value
1272212
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8fd4eac25cae2b59083777de7834a885ab754c2 OP_EQUAL
address
3JZ9hwYmvJqTVLKojBL1i3JBbnTMfQJ9LP
transaction
bacc26d565252b2b23a6f1e53ed3ecc786163b945414afb6c1c686640d06085d
confirmations
247030
spent
true